.Dd May 10, 2008 .Dt VM_MAP_FIND 9 .Os .Sh NAME .Nm vm_map_find .Nd find a free region within a map, and optionally map a vm_object .Sh SYNOPSIS n sys/param.h n vm/vm.h n vm/vm_map.h .Ft int .Fo vm_map_find .Fa "vm_map_t map" "vm_object_t object" "vm_ooffset_t offset" .Fa "vm_offset_t *addr" "vm_size_t length" "int find_space" .Fa "vm_prot_t prot" "vm_prot_t max" "int cow" .Fc .Sh DESCRIPTION The .Fn vm_map_find function attempts to find a free region in the target .Fa map , with the given .Fa length , and will also optionally create a mapping of .Fa object .

p The arguments .Fa offset , .Fa prot , .Fa max , and .Fa cow are passed unchanged to .Xr vm_map_insert 9 when creating the mapping, if and only if a free region is found.

p If .Fa object is

f non- Dv NULL , the reference count on the object must be incremented by the caller before calling this function to account for the new entry.

p If .Fa find_space is either .Dv VMFS_ALIGNED_SPACE or .Dv VMFS_ANY_SPACE , the function will call .Xr vm_map_findspace 9 to discover a free region. Moreover, if .Fa find_space is .Dv VMFS_ALIGNED_SPACE , the address of the free region will be optimized for the use of superpages. Otherwise, if .Fa find_space is .Dv VMFS_NO_SPACE , .Xr vm_map_insert 9 is called with the given address, .Fa addr . .Sh IMPLEMENTATION NOTES This function acquires a lock on .Fa map by calling .Xr vm_map_lock 9 , and holds it until the function returns.

p The search for a free region is defined to be first-fit, from the address .Fa addr onwards. .Sh RETURN VALUES The .Fn vm_map_find function returns .Dv KERN_SUCCESS if the mapping was successfully created. If space could not be found or .Fa find_space was .Dv VMFS_NO_SPACE and the given address, .Fa addr , was already mapped, .Dv KERN_NO_SPACE will be returned. If the discovered range turned out to be bogus, .Dv KERN_INVALID_ADDRESS will be returned. .Sh SEE ALSO .Xr vm_map 9 , .Xr vm_map_findspace 9 , .Xr vm_map_insert 9 , .Xr vm_map_lock 9 .Sh AUTHORS This manual page was written by .An Bruce M Simpson Aq bms@spc.org .
